Cesko-narodni sin-Milligan Auditorium, also known as Milligan Auditorium, is a historic building in Milligan, Nebraska, USA, that was built in 1929. It was listed on the National Register of Historic Places on February 29, 1996. The building is a meeting hall for the Czech community. It historically hosted dances, Sokol events, films and Czech theater.
